FDA Approves AMO Cataract Lens

Advanced Medical Optics Inc. said Wednesday that the Food and Drug Administration approved its Tecnis intraocular lens for cataract patients.

Tecnis is a foldable acrylic replacement lens.

Santa Ana-based Advanced Medical said the regulatory OK was a milestone for the company because the lens was developed using technology from its $450 million buy of Pfizer Inc.’s ophthalmic surgery business as well as in-house lens technology.

Advanced Medical said it planned to start selling Tecnis in the U.S. and Europe in September.

Shares of the eye surgery and contact lens company were up 0.5% to $40 in trading on Wednesday.
